How Barbers Can Get More Google Reviews

Google reviews can help potential clients understand the quality, reliability and atmosphere of a barbershop. Reviews should always be genuine and based on real client experiences.

Safe ways to ask for reviews

  • Ask happy clients after a good appointment.
  • Send a review link after the service.
  • Add a review link to booking follow up messages.
  • Place a small sign near reception.
  • Reply politely to existing reviews.

What not to do

Do not offer discounts, free services or gifts in exchange for reviews. Do not ask staff, friends or fake accounts to leave misleading reviews. Do not pressure clients to leave only positive feedback.

Timing matters

The best time to ask is soon after a successful appointment, when the result is fresh and the client is satisfied.

Make it easy

Use a direct review link and keep the request short. Clients are more likely to respond when the process takes little effort.

Replying to reviews

Thank clients for positive reviews. For negative reviews, stay calm, professional and avoid personal arguments. A measured reply can reassure future clients.

Simple review request

Thanks for visiting today. If you were happy with the service, a quick Google review would really help our barbershop.
